How it works

Make a cross stitch pattern in four steps

Start with a photo, adjust the chart for your fabric and stitching style, then download the pattern you want to make.

Read the complete photo-to-pattern guide
01

Upload a photo or picture

Choose a clear JPG, PNG, HEIC, or WebP image. Pets, portraits, flowers, and simple objects work especially well.

02

Frame the subject

Crop and position the part of the image you want to stitch, then choose the finished size and Aida fabric count.

03

Generate and refine

Create the chart, adjust the stitchability and DMC palette, and make manual edits until the pattern feels right for your project.

04

Download your pattern

Export a print-ready PDF with symbols, floss details, and project information, or download a high-resolution JPG chart.

Good to know

Cross stitch converter FAQ

Learn how the free cross stitch pattern generator handles your photo, colours, edits, and downloads.

Is there a free cross stitch pattern generator?

Yes. StitchBitz is a free cross stitch pattern maker: upload a photo, generate an editable DMC chart, and download a PDF or JPG without an account.

Can I convert a photo to cross stitch?

Yes. Upload a JPG, PNG, HEIC, or WebP photo and StitchBitz converts the image into a counted cross stitch chart. You can crop the picture, choose a finished size, and tune how much detail the pattern keeps.

Does the cross stitch converter store my photo?

No. Image processing and pattern generation run in your browser, so your photo stays on your device and is not uploaded to StitchBitz.

What do I get when I make a cross stitch pattern?

You get an editable chart mapped to real DMC floss colours, plus a printable PDF with the symbol chart, floss list, and project details. A high-resolution JPG chart is also available.
